Charlie Sheen reflects on his departure from the popular sitcom Two and a Half Men after facing issues with drug use and on-set troubles. He is eager to reconnect with his former co-star Jon Cryer, who played alongside him on the show. An upcoming Netflix documentary titled aka Charlie Sheen is set to premiere on September 10th, featuring insights from various individuals, including Cryer. Despite not personally reaching out to Cryer, Sheen expressed gratitude for Cryer's honest and compassionate contributions in the documentary and hopes to reconnect with him in the future.

Although Sheen has not received a direct response from Cryer, he publicly extends a plea for Cryer to contact him, suggesting that he may have used the wrong contact information. While Sheen was able to reunite with Two and a Half Men creator Chuck Lorre through a different project, the possibility of reviving the sitcom is unlikely. Sheen acknowledges that he values his former co-star's well-being but is not actively seeking a reunion for the show.
